Robilante is a comune (municipality) in the Province of Cuneo in the Italian region Piedmont, located about 90 kilometres (56 mi) south of Turin and about 10 kilometres (6 mi) southwest of Cuneo. As of 31 December 2004, it had a population of 2,362 and an area of 24.9 square kilometres (9.6 sq mi).[1]

The municipality of Robilante contains the frazioni (subdivisions, mainly villages and hamlets) Tetto Pettavino, montasso, and Tetto Chiappello.

Robilante borders the following municipalities: Boves, Roaschia, Roccavione, and Vernante.
